As we make our return to Class 3A this week, we got to see some very impressive performances from the defenders playing in the box, disrupting the offense, and contributing to statement wins as we are closing in on the finish line for the 2024 high school football regular season. We take a look at 4 defensive-linemen and 4 Linebackers that stood out this week in Class 3A!
